## Introduce per-tenant rate quotas in the Orvane gateway

For the release manager: this change replaces our global throttle with per-tenant quotas, resolved at request time from the tenant registry and cached for sixty seconds. Tenants without an explicit quota inherit the tier default; overage returns a retryable status with a hint header. Rollout is gated behind a flag, defaulting off, and the old throttle remains as a backstop until two clean release cycles pass.

The initial tier defaults we intend to ship are listed below.

limits module of taguf-hafog:
WEIGHTS = {
    "wenox": 690,
    "wenok": 782,
    "kelax": 41,
    "holox": 338,
    "quenir": 39,
}

## Deployment

Integration tests for Tollgate's payments core occasionally fail on the ledger-reconciliation suite due to timing races in the sandbox clearinghouse. Retry once before investigating; twice-failed runs block deploys. Never skip the suite manually. Before deploying, confirm your environment matches the approved settings shown below.

settings of fafog-haduf:
ZORIX_PIN=4648
ZORIX_METRICS_HOST=metrics.zorix.paliqsys.corp
ZORIX_LOG_LEVEL=info
ZORIX_TENANT=druix

**Timeline — 09:41.** The Haulport fleet fuel-usage report for the Brindlemoor depot began emitting doubled litre totals. Cause traced to the aggregation job reading both the legacy odometer feed and the new telemetry stream after the cutover flag was left enabled. Reviewer note: the fix removes the legacy read path entirely rather than gating it, per our earlier decision to retire the feed. Doubled figures appeared only in this window; earlier reports are unaffected. The corrected report was produced by the build below.

pipeline stamp: htk21_86b657ac0aa916a9af17f